The details

The recent earthquake in southern Iran measured 5.2 on the Richter scale and occurred in the early hours of the morning. This timing raises concerns about the vulnerability of people who are asleep during such events. The depth of the quake is consistent with previous seismic activity in the region, suggesting a recurring pattern that could be valuable for scientists and disaster experts. Monitoring stations around the world detected and accurately measured the earthquake, but the lack of immediate information about damage or impact highlights the challenges in rapid information dissemination during crises.

  • The earthquake struck in the early hours of the morning on April 12, 2026.
